Common boiler types and fuel options
Understanding the main boiler types and fuels helps match a system to your home and local fuel availability.
- Cast iron and non-condensing boilers: robust for older systems and hydronic baseboard installations; lower upfront cost but lower efficiency.
- Condensing boilers: high AFUE ratings when return-water temperatures are low; ideal where heat emitters allow efficient heat transfer.
- Combi boilers: combine space heating and domestic hot water in one compact unit; good for homes with limited space and moderate simultaneous demand.
- System boilers: separate indirect water heater but integrated pump and controls, used in homes with higher hot water needs.
- Fuel options:
- Natural gas: common and often most economical where gas service is available.
- Propane: used in areas without natural gas; similar appliance choices to gas.
- Oil: still common in many Pennsylvania homes; modern oil boilers have improved but require proper chimney and tank considerations.
- Electric: simple to install but typically higher operating cost for continuous heating in cold climates.
- Controls: modulating burners, outdoor reset, and smart thermostats improve efficiency and comfort across fuels.
Initial home/site assessment and system sizing
A thorough assessment prevents common problems like short cycling, poor comfort, and premature wear.
Assessment includes:
- Calculating heat load using the home’s square footage, insulation levels, window types, and local design temperature for Spry, PA to determine required BTU output.
- Evaluating existing distribution system (radiators, baseboard, in-floor) to determine compatibility with new boiler water temperatures.
- Inspecting venting, chimney condition, and combustion air sources for fuel-specific requirements.
- Reviewing domestic hot water needs and whether an indirect tank or combi unit is preferred.
- Checking boiler room access, clearances, and any retrofit constraints in older homes.
Proper sizing matters. Oversized boilers short cycle and waste fuel; undersized units cannot maintain comfort during the coldest days in Spry. A heat load calculation based on local climate and home specifics yields the correct boiler capacity.
Comparing efficiency and long-term operating cost
- AFUE rating: higher AFUE means better seasonal efficiency. Condensing boilers often exceed 90 percent AFUE when operating within their design conditions.
- Modulating-condensing boilers: adjust firing rate to match load, improving comfort and reducing wear from frequent on/off cycles.
- Distribution compatibility: systems designed for lower water temperatures enable condensing boilers to operate more efficiently.
- Insulate distribution piping, upgrade controls, and consider zoning to reduce operating costs in partially occupied homes.

Professional installation steps and typical timeline
A professional installation follows a structured process to minimize surprises and deliver reliable performance. Typical steps and timeframes:
- Final site walkthrough and permit submission (1 to 3 days after estimate).
- Removal of old equipment and preparation of space (1 day).
- Installation of new boiler, controls, piping, and venting modifications (1 to 3 days depending on system complexity).
- Connection to fuel supply, electrical, and any indirect water heater (same day as installation).
- System fill, air purging, and initial start-up (a few hours).
- Combustion analysis, venting check, and final adjustments (same day).
- Inspection and commissioning paperwork for permits (1 to 5 business days depending on municipal scheduling).
Total on-site time typically ranges from one to several days; complex retrofits or fuel changes can extend the timeline.
Commissioning, warranty, and post-installation testing
Commissioning confirms the system operates safely and efficiently.
Essential commissioning steps:
- Combustion test to confirm safe and efficient fuel burn and correct draft.
- Leak test of fuel lines and hydronic piping.
- Verification of flow rates, pump operation, and proper zoning control.
- Programming and verifying thermostats, outdoor reset, and control sequences.
- Measuring supply and return temperatures to ensure condensing performance when applicable.
- Demonstrating system operation and maintenance needs for homeowners.
Warranty considerations:
- Manufacturer limited warranties cover parts and often require professional installation for full coverage.
- Labor warranties may be provided separately for a defined period.
- Keep installation records, combustion analysis reports, and permit approvals for warranty claims and resale value.

Maintenance and long-term benefits
Regular maintenance extends boiler life and preserves efficiency:
- Annual combustion and safety inspection.
- Flushing or treating hydronic loops to control corrosion and deposits.
- Checking expansion tanks, pressure relief valves, and circulator pumps.
- Monitoring fuel storage and piping for oil or propane systems.
